Title: A Step In The Right Direction
Author: Brandy
Pairing: Maj. Sheppard/OFC
Fandom: Stargate Atlantis
Spoilers: "Rising" pt 2
Summary: About two years after their divorce, Maj. John Sheppard and Dr. Abby Caldwell are in Atlantis. Which is sure to be the most exciting journey of their lives.
Major John Sheppard walked through the halls of Atlantis, after excusing himself from the party out on the balcony. Room assignments had been given out and it was relatively easy to find his quarters.
Back out on the balcony, still enjoying the party and conversing with Teyla's people, Dr. Abby Caldwell looked around, but found no sign of Major Sheppard. Excusing herself from her conversation, she went inside and to look for him. He had told her where his quarters were and it didn't take her long to find them. As she approached, the doors automatically opened, she unconsciously backed up, wondering if she would ever get used to this new world.
When the door opened, Sheppard sat up. "Who's there?"
"It's me." She said softly.
He rubbed his eyes, "Come in." He motioned her inside and the doors swooshed shut as she entered. He thought about the light levels being higher and it was done, he had to adjust to the sudden light that illuminated the room.
She smiled shyly, "I'm sorry. I didn't know you were asleep. I could come back later," she started to back up.
"No, no please." He offered her a spot next to him on the bed. She took it and sat nervously with her hands in her lap. "Did you make any progress today?"
"Yeah, we did actually."
"That's good." He smiled, and she couldn't help but smile back. "I saw you talking to one of Telya's people."
"Yeah, I was asking him about rituals in his culture, and other stuff." She softly laughed, tentatively reached out a hand to smooth some of his hair back into place, surprised when he didn't pull away. It'd been a long time since they were this close. It felt good and no matter how she tried to fight it, she realized that she was still in love with him. "Your hair was..."
"Yeah." He breathed, she was wearing the perfume he'd bought for her before they left Earth and it smelled heavenly. "Is that...?"
"Yeah." She smiled. "You like?"
"Yeah, I like." His lips turned upwards in a small smile. Even after their marriage had ended, they still remained good friends. They'd talked on the phone for hours at a time, sometimes even-- a whole night. She'd cringe when her phone bill came but then, when she thought back to her conversations with John she didn't regret a minute. "Abby..."
"Uh, yeah, sorry." She rubbed her forehead and smiled.
"You look tired." Sheppard commented and brushed a strand of hair, that had escaped from her ponytail she'd kept it in, back behind her ear.
"I think you should be more tired, after your adventures today." She smiled, indeed, she'd heard the tale from Lt. Ford who still didn't seem tired of telling it.
"Yeah, but I've got a beautiful woman sitting beside me. I'll make an exception." He smiled. She yawned and rested her head on his shoulder. His hand went to stroke her hair, as if it was second nature. He still had to remind himself sometimes that she wasn't his anymore.
"Mmmm. You've still got the touch." She said almost asleep.
"I don't think I lost it." He cheekily replied.
"Enough smartass for today."
"Yes ma'am." He softly whispered into her hair. "Would you like to stay?"
"They haven't gotten to our room assignments yet.." another yawn, "and your bed feels awfully comfortable." She smirked.
"Then by all means stay." The truth was he didn't want her to leave.
"If you insist." She was almost asleep.
"If you'll let me reposition myself, this bed's definitely big enough for the both of us." He smiled.
"Sure." She stood up, and opened her eyes, seeing him move around until he was on the right side of the bed and laid down, snuggling against him. "Just like I remember."
"Yeah," he stroked through her hair again and lightly brushed his lips over the top of her head.
"Johnny?"
"You haven't called me that in a long time."
"You're doing it again," she smiled.
"I don't hear you complaining." He chided, when he didn't receive an answer from her, he looked down and noticed her breathing had evened out. "Sweet dreams, princess." He lowered the light level again and fell into a peaceful slumber with Abby in his arms.
